Understanding the Door of Dreams: A Path to Discovery

Dreaming of walking into a door can be a profound experience, evoking feelings of curiosity, fear, or excitement. Doors in dreams symbolize transitions and opportunities, often reflecting our subconscious desires and feelings about the changes we may be facing in our waking lives. They can represent a passage to new experiences, insights, and growth, often signaling that you are on the brink of something new.

Whether it be a career change, personal transformation, or emotional growth, walking through a door in a dream may invite you to explore new possibilities or confront challenges. By examining the details of your dream—the door's appearance, how you felt approaching it, and what lay beyond—you can unravel the deeper messages your subconscious is trying to convey. It's essential to approach these dreams with an open heart and mind, for they carry valuable wisdom about your life’s journey.

Symbols

  • door
    • Lintel:

      (Door lintel; Doorplate; Threshold) In a dream, the doorstep of one’s house represents one’s power, or it could mean marriage. If one sees himself removing the doorstep of his house in a dream, it means losing his power. If he removes the door lintels of his house in a dream, it means divorcing his wife.

      If the door lintels are taken away and one could no longer see them in the dream, it means his death. If he can still see them in the dream, then it means a sickness from which he will recover. The door lintel in a dream also represents a woman or the house bottler.

      If a governor sees the doorsteps of his house being removed in a dream, it means that he will be impeached. Whatever happens to the doorsteps in a dream should be interpreted as relating to one’s wife or a woman.

  • sauntering
    • Highway:

      (Astray; Error; Lost) Walking on a straight highway and still losing one’s way in a dream means deviating from the path of truth. If the road in the dream is twisted or curved, then it means allurement, trespassing, misguidance, or erring from God’s path, or it could mean seeking a way out of error. If one is lost in the dream, it means that he will become heedless, and if he finds his way thereafter, it means that he will receive someone’s guidance and accept it.

      Waning of one’s wealth:

    • Strutting:

      (Jogging; Prancing; Strutting; Tripping) Walking straight in a dream means profits, seeking the path of righteousness and unwavering in one’s religious commitment. Walking through the markets in a dream means carrying a will, or should one qualify for leadership, it means that he may be appointed to fill such a position. Walking barefooted in a dream means dispelling distress and portraying a good religious character.

      The meaning of walking in a dream implies an expression of meekness and submissiveness before one’s Lord, and it could mean seeking to earn one’s livelihood. Jogging in a dream means victory over one’s enemy. Walking backward in a dream means reversing one’s decision, cancelling a commitment, or it could represent corruption in one’s religious practices.

      Strutting or prancing in a dream represents an ugly state of mind that is coupled with evil actions. Falling down over one’s face during walking in a dream means loss of benefits in this world and in the next. Tripping while walking in a dream means exposure of one’s ills, and suffering the consequences of wrongdoing.

      To cause someone to trip while walking in a dream means ridiculing him, or delivering him a humiliating blow. To walk earnestly and steadily in a dream represents one’s good intention. Travelling on foot in a dream means facing danger.

      Walking while bowing one’s head in a dream means longevity, or it could mean recovering from a long illness. Walking over the clouds in a dream means rain. Walking with a cane in a dream means old age, or an illness which will require the help of a cane.

      Hopping on one foot in a dream means losing half of one’s wealth. Having several feet in a dream means losing one’s sight. If the governor sees himself having many feet in a dream, it means that he will be impeached from his office.

      If one sees inanimate objects such as a tree, a rock or a mountain walking in a dream, it represents major adversities and plagues. The movement of inanimate objects in a dream also means being dogmatic about one’s spiritual stand. Walking like animals in a dream means emulating ignorant people, seeking the unattainable, or being a hypocrite, unless if the animal is permissible for food, then such style of walking means offering good deeds.

  • entrance
    • Hereafter:

      If one sees himself entering the heavenly paradise in a dream, then his dream represents glad tidings that God willing, he shall enter it. If a pilgrim sees himself entering paradise in a dream, it means that his pilgrimage is accepted or that he will reach God’s House in Mecca. If he lacks faith in God Almighty, it means that he will become a believer.

      If a believer who is bed- stricken sees himself entering paradise in a dream, it means that he will die of his illness. If a non-believer who is bed-stricken sees himself entering paradise in a dream, it means that he will recover from his illness. If he is unwed, it means that he will get married.

      If he is poor, it means that he will become rich or receive an inheritance. If a sick person sees himself in the abode of the hereafter healthy again in a dream, it means that he will reach it free from the ills of this world, its adversities and temptations. If he is not sick, then entering the realms of the hereafter means glad tidings, business success, a pilgrimage, ascetic detachment from this world, sincere devotion, acquiring knowledge, strengthening of one’s kinship or exercising patience toward a calamity which derives from one’s own sins.

      If one sees himself entering the abode of the hereafter to visit and see around, and should he be a person of good deeds and character who is a capable person and who acts upon his knowledge, it means that he will be without work or suffer from business losses. If he is scared of something, or if he is accused of something, or if he is under stress, it means that his fears will dissipate. Mostly, entering the abode of the hereafter in a dream means travels or migration from one’s homeland.

      Thus, if one sees himself returning from a journey to the hereafter in a dream, it means that he will return to his homeland. Entering paradise in a dream means a pilgrimage to God’s House in Mecca.

Navigating Your Dream Insights

  • Reflect on Your Current Life Situation

    Take time to ponder your current circumstances and any changes you are contemplating. Are there opportunities or decisions you are facing that resonate with the symbolism of a door? Journaling about your feelings and experiences related to these choices can provide clarity.

    Consider also how you felt in the dream—were you excited, anxious, or indifferent? These emotions may reflect your true feelings about the situation at hand. This reflective practice can help you align your actions in waking life with the guidance your dreams offer, enabling you to embrace new paths with confidence and purpose.

  • Examine the Type of Door

    The nature of the door in your dream holds significance. An open door may suggest welcoming new opportunities, while a closed door might indicate barriers or unresolved issues. Reflecting on these elements can help you understand the specific challenges or adventures that lie ahead.

    Try to recall the door's color, its condition, and whether it was inviting or intimidating. Taking note of these details can reveal important insights into the decisions you need to make in your life, guiding you on whether to pursue certain pathways or reconsider your approach.

  • Seek Guidance from Trusted Sources

    If the dream stirs deep emotions or uncertainty, consulting with someone knowledgeable about dreams or your own spiritual guide can be beneficial. Talking through your dream may help unlock insights that you may not see alone. This could be a trusted friend, a family member, or a community leader who understands dream interpretations within your cultural context.

    Their perspective can offer additional clarity and support as you navigate your thoughts. Remember, reaching out to others can often provide the strength and encouragement needed to step through the doors in your waking life.

FAQs

  • What does it mean to dream of a closed door?

    Dreaming of a closed door often symbolizes feelings of restriction or missed opportunities. It may suggest that there are aspects of your life that you feel unable to access or explore. This can reflect inner fears or unresolved issues that need attention before you can move forward. It's a sign to consider what barriers might be holding you back, encouraging you to face challenges with courage.

  • Is dreaming about walking into a door common?

    Yes, it is quite common to dream about doors! They often represent transitions, choices, and new beginnings, making them a frequent motif in our subconscious as we navigate life changes. Many people report such dreams during significant transitions, such as moving jobs or entering new relationships. Therefore, these dreams resonate with many individuals and carry rich symbolic meanings.

  • Does the type of door affect the dream’s meaning?

    Absolutely! The type of door can provide specific insights. For example, an ornate or grand door might symbolize significant opportunities or a prestigious choice, whereas a simple, plain door may represent more intimate or subtle changes. Reflecting on the door's details and your feelings about it can further clarify its meaning within your dream narrative.

  • How can I interpret the emotions I felt while dreaming?

    The emotions you experience in your dreams are crucial for interpretation. If you felt joy while approaching the door, it may reflect an eagerness to embrace new opportunities. Conversely, if you felt fear, it might signify apprehension about upcoming changes. Recognizing these feelings can guide your understanding of the dream, providing insights into your emotional state regarding your waking life.

  • What should I do if I have recurring dreams about doors?

    Recurring dreams often highlight unresolved issues or persistent thoughts in your life. It's beneficial to take note of these recurring themes and see what they reveal about your current state. Consider what areas of your life require attention or change. Engaging in self-reflection or discussing with a mentor or therapist can help uncover the messages behind these dreams and facilitate personal growth.
